Transaction 07fa12512217cae573741bd15ec91ce129699b5a5883233dddba09ca1d31d578

1 Input
2 Outputs
  • 07fa12512217cae573741bd15ec91ce129699b5a5883233dddba09ca1d31d578:0
  • value  14970000
    address  33ccngh41f3HhRTELRUyrGzsfwFXZBLqzv
  • 07fa12512217cae573741bd15ec91ce129699b5a5883233dddba09ca1d31d578:1
  • value  1792258
    address  bc1q3rnvllzemhjczuu75a68tqqm2fwxp6nhgtx0pp